Introduction to the UK Sanitation Community of Practice

The UK sanitation community of practice (SanCoP) is an initiative convened by the International Water Association (IWA), the Water, Engineering and Development Centre (WEDC) and Building Partnerships for Development in Water and Sanitation (BPD), and aim to strengthen the UK sanitation sector by providing a forum for learning and debate. We hold meetings on a bi-annual basis, and bring together a wide range of professionals with an interest in sanitation from academic and research institutions, NGOs, and public and private organisations, for stimulating presentations, knowledge sharing, networking and lively debate. Participants’ backgrounds’ include engineering, public health, social and political science, economics and urban development disciplines. SanCoP workshops take place twice a year under Chatham House rules allowing lively debate on topical sanitation issues.

Since it began in 2008, SanCoP has developed a network of over 250 members, has successfully run 12 events on a range of topics related to sanitation and has produced a number of written outputs on the subject area.
